Route immersed in the wild Val Valorz between imposing waterfalls and wonderful alpine lakes.
High difficulty hike that, entering the Val Valorz, first meets the spectacular Valorz Waterfalls and then proceeds into a sparse larch forest, reaching a small body of water: the Soprasasso Lake. The trail continues along steep slopes to Lago Rotondo and to Lago Quarto and Lago Alto. Finally, following the shores of the last of the three lakes, it reaches Passo Valletta, a majestic panoramic point with a splendid view over the valley.

Once you have parked the car in Val Valorz, after the bridge over the Rabbies stream, take the SAT 121 trail which first leads to the Valorz Waterfalls and shortly after to a sparse larch wood, to the Soprasasso Lake. Following the lake northwest, you then reach Lago Rotondo. Passing this one, you climb on the right, reaching near Lago Quarto and after a grassy stretch, to Lago Alto. A few minutes later it is possible to reach Passo Valletta with a wonderful panorama over the valley. The return is planned along the same route.
It is also possible to climb to Lago Alto and Lago Rotondo starting from Malga Stabli, easily reachable by car on a dirt road from Ortisé, and proceed along the road crossing green and wide pastures until you reach Malga Bronzolo at an altitude of 2,083 meters. Leaving the malga behind, continue along the SAT 121A trail towards Passo Valletta, from which you can already glimpse the two lakes embedded among the rocks. Then descend to reach Lago Alto and then Lago Rotondo at 2424 meters altitude. The return is also planned along the same route.
You can reach San Bernardo with the Trentino Trasporti line bus MALÈ - RABBI BAGNI - SOMRABBI (download the departure and return schedules).
Follow the SS42 to the village of Terzolas and at the roundabout take the second exit for Val di Rabbi, and follow the SP86 to the village of San Bernardo. After the village, take the road from the Pralongo locality leading to the Valorz waterfalls and after the small bridge over the Rabbies stream, leave the car at the parking lot at 1245 m altitude.
